Hypebot publishes a morning roundup of music  industry news every     weekday morning prior to 11AM ET and when warranted will add a PM  Update    edition around 4:30PM ET.

  • We're hearing that eMusic is planning a major overhaul for later this year that will include more of a community focus along with the "access anywhere" cloud music locker they teased late last year.
  • As part of the aggressive marketing for Lykke Li and this week's global sophomore release ‘Wounded Rhymes’, Atlantic launched an innovative cross-platform web / mobile members’ area. Not a cheap or easy venture, but worth checking out.
  • Yet another cloud music locker Mougg has launched. Synch not offered.
